🛕 Cultural Landmarks & Historic Sights
Bangkok is home to some of Thailand’s most iconic attractions:
-
The Grand Palace & Wat Phra Kaew – The most famous landmark in the city
-
Wat Arun (Temple of Dawn) – Stunning riverside views, especially at sunset
-
Wat Pho – Home to the Reclining Buddha and traditional Thai massage school
-
Jim Thompson House – A fascinating insight into Thai silk and heritage
These locations are must-see spots and are open year-round for visitors.

🛍️ Markets, Shopping & Local Finds
Bangkok is world-famous for shopping, from street markets to luxury malls:
-
Chatuchak Weekend Market – One of the largest markets in the world
-
Asiatique The Riverfront – Night market, entertainment, and dining
-
ICONSIAM & Siam Paragon – Luxury shopping and attractions
-
Jodd Fairs & Train Night Markets – Street food, fashion, and souvenirs
You’ll find something interesting around every corner.
